Real Reviews From Verified Customers

Search instead for North Miami Beach, FL
Hialeah Gardens, FL 33018
Distance: 10.5 mi.
5 out of 5
4 Reviews
Miami, FL 33137
Distance: 10.6 mi.
Fort Lauderdale, FL 33315
Distance: 10.6 mi.
Miami, FL 33142
Distance: 10.6 mi.
Miami, FL 33137
Distance: 10.7 mi.
Miami, FL 33142
Distance: 10.7 mi.